Multiple Bumps On Head Under Skin

 

 

Multiple bumps on head under the skin can be caused by a variety of conditions, from harmless cysts to more serious medical issues. These bumps can appear as small, firm lumps or larger, fluid-filled cysts. They may be painless or cause discomfort, and may appear in various shapes and sizes. It is important to pay attention to any changes in the size or texture of these bumps as they may indicate an underlying health condition.Multiple bumps under the skin on the head can be caused by a variety of medical conditions, including cysts, lipomas, or boils. Cysts are non-cancerous growths filled with fluid or other material and can often appear suddenly. Lipomas are benign fatty tumors that can form anywhere on the body, including the head. Boils are a type of skin infection that forms when bacteria enters an open wound or hair follicle. In addition, allergic reactions to certain products such as shampoos or styling products can also cause bumps under the skin on the head. It is important to consult a doctor if you experience any of these symptoms so they can diagnose the underlying cause and provide appropriate treatment.

Symptoms of Multiple Bumps Under Skin on Head

Multiple bumps under skin on the head can cause a variety of symptoms, including redness, pain, itching, and swelling. These bumps can range in size from small pinpricks to large lumps. They may also be filled with fluid or pus. In some cases, these bumps may even appear to be filled with blood. In addition to the physical symptoms, multiple bumps under the skin on the head can also lead to psychological distress as they are often cosmetically displeasing. It is important to note that multiple bumps under the skin on the head can be caused by a variety of conditions including infections, allergic reactions, and even cancerous growths.

Infections such as acne or boils can lead to multiple bumps under the skin on the head. Acne is most commonly found in teenagers but can occur at any age and typically presents as an accumulation of blackheads or whiteheads which may become inflamed and develop into painful pustules or cysts. Boils are deeply rooted infections that form a pus-filled lump beneath the surface of the skin and are typically caused by bacterial infection.

Allergic reactions such as contact dermatitis can also cause multiple bumps under the skin on the head. This type of rash occurs when an allergen comes into contact with sensitive skin and causes an immune response which results in redness, itching, swelling and even blisters in some cases. Common allergens include certain soaps, cosmetics, metals or fabrics that come into contact with your scalp or hair products you use regularly.

In rare cases, these types of bumps may be caused by cancerous growths such as basal cell carcinoma or squamous cell carcinoma which grow slowly beneath the surface of the skin without causing any pain or discomfort until they become large enough to be noticed visually. It is important to see a doctor right away if any suspicious looking bumps appear beneath your scalp so they can be properly diagnosed and treated if necessary.

Diagnosis of Multiple Bumps Under Skin on Head

Multiple bumps under the skin on the head can be concerning and may be caused by a variety of underlying medical conditions. It is important to seek medical attention to properly diagnose and treat the issue. A doctor will be able to determine the cause of the bumps, as well as any other potential underlying issues.

The doctor may ask questions about your medical history, including any recent illnesses or injuries that may have caused the bumps. The doctor will also likely perform a physical examination of the bumps, including a visual inspection and palpation, which involves feeling for any lumps or abnormalities beneath the skin.

In some cases, additional tests may be necessary to diagnose multiple bumps under the skin on the head. These tests may include a biopsy, in which a small sample of tissue is taken from one of the bumps and analyzed for signs of infection or cancer. Blood tests may also be used to check for signs of infection or other underlying health conditions that could be responsible for the bumps.

Complications of Multiple Bumps Under Skin on Head

Bumps under the skin on the head can be caused by a variety of conditions, ranging from cysts to abscesses. While most of these bumps are harmless and may not require any treatment, in some cases they can lead to complications that require medical attention. Multiple bumps under the skin on the head may be indicative of an underlying condition that should be addressed by a medical professional.

In some cases, multiple bumps under the skin on the head can be caused by an infection. This is especially true when they are accompanied by other symptoms such as fever, redness, and swelling. Infections of the scalp can range from bacterial infections such as folliculitis and impetigo to fungal infections such as ringworm or tinea capitis. In some cases, these infections may require treatment with antibiotics or antifungal medications.

Multiple bumps under the skin on the head can also be caused by cysts or other growths such as sebaceous cysts or lipomas. These types of growths are usually harmless but may need to be removed if they become painful or uncomfortable. In some cases, these growths may need to be biopsied to rule out any serious underlying conditions such as skin cancer.

In rare cases, multiple bumps under the skin on the head can be a sign of a more serious condition such as leukemia or lymphoma. These types of cancers often cause swollen lymph nodes in various parts of the body including the head and neck area.
